Education & Qualifications in Hoddys Well

How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.

Lower levels of formal schooling and degrees than most similar areas define Hoddys Well. Only 44.8% of residents finished Year 12, which is far below the national figure of 58.8%. This trend carries through to higher education, where those with a bachelor degree or higher make up just 9.8% of the adult population.

Schooling

Highest year of school completed.

Fewer people here finished high school compared to the rest of the state, with only 44.8% completing Year 12. This is far below the Western Australian figure of 58.0%.

Qualifications

Post-school qualifications and degrees.

University degrees are uncommon here; only 9.8% of adults hold a bachelor degree or higher, which is far below the national figure of 26.3%. Instead, the most common highest qualification is a Certificate III or IV, held by 41.3% of people.

Field of study

What people studied.

Among those with qualifications, the most common fields are Engineering (22.7%), Management and commerce (20.0%), and Health (18.7%).
